Variant namesChester Naramore earned his A.B. in geology at Stanford University in 1903. While at Stanford, he was on the varsity track team, Business Manager for the 1903 Stanford Quad, member of the Geology Society, vice-president of the student body during his senior year, and active in Encina Club affairs. He married Grace Ellen Chilson on March 15, 1904. He pursued a career as geologist and company executive with several oil and gas companies.
